Proper use of asthma controller medications is critical in reducing asthma mortality and morbidity. The clinical consequences of poor asthma management include increased illness complications, excessive functional morbidity, and fatal asthma attacks. There are significant limitations in research on interventions to improve asthma management in racial minority populations, particularly minority adolescents and young adults, though illness management tends to deteriorate after adolescence during emerging adulthood, the unique developmental period beyond adolescence but before adulthood. All elements of the proposed study protocol were piloted in an NHLBI-funded pilot study (1R34HL107664-01A1 MacDonell). Results suggested feasibility and acceptability of the study protocol as well as proof of concept. The intervention is now being tested in a larger randomized clinical trial. The proposed study will include 192 African American emerging adults with moderate to severe persistent asthma and low controller medication adherence recruited from clinic and emergency department settings. Half of the sample will be randomized to receive a multi-component technology-based intervention (MCTI) targeting adherence to daily controller medication. The MCTI consists of two components: 1) 2 sessions of computer-delivered motivational interviewing targeting medication adherence, and 2) individualized text messaging focused on medication adherence between the sessions. Text messages will be individualized based on Ecological Momentary Assessment (EMA). The remaining half of participants will complete a series of computer-delivered asthma education modules matched for length, location, and method of delivery of the intervention session. Control participants will also receive text messages between intervention sessions. Message content will be the same for all control participants and contain general facts about asthma (not tailored). Youth will be recruited from the Detroit Medical Center, the only university affiliated medical center in Detroit, Michigan. Sessions are provided by an avatar. The intervention engages the youth with the avatar's communication of empathy, optimism, and autonomy support. The intervention focuses the youth on adherence and relevant health behaviors with feedback on adherence, asthma symptoms, and tailored education. Participants are guided in the planning process through goal setting activities.
